As a Lead Diesel Mechanic at First Student, you’ll schedule and perform school bus fleet maintenance, diagnose and troubleshoot complex problems, and maintain service records. Other job duties include:
Supervise technicians in the shop.
Generate work orders and track progress through completion.
Maintain advanced knowledge of all vehicle components to effectively diagnose and perform maintenance and repairs.
Monitor shop operational performance and efficiency and take action to improve as needed.
Lead Diesel Mechanic Qualifications:
Valid driver's license required; willingness to obtain CDL while employed – we train!
At least 5 years of automotive or diesel maintenance & repair experience or technical school education.
Previous experience in a lead technician, supervisor, or other management role is preferred.
Possess a mechanic’s tool set.
Willingness to participate in ASE certification program. Training, testing, and bonuses provided!
Subject to DOT drug and alcohol testing as a safety-sensitive employee. DOT Regulation 49 CFR Part 40 does not authorize the use of Schedule I drugs, including marijuana, for any reason.
